The 22nd Annual CYCLE ACROSS ILLINOIS benefiting Illinois Concerns Of Police Survivors (IL COPS) will take place Thursday, July 9 – Sunday July 12, 2026.The Cycle Across Illinois bicycle ride recognizes and honors the extraordinary contributions of law enforcement officers who have died in the line of duty. In 2025 several officers lost their lives due to different causes. The committee decided to honor the officers whose names will be going onto the National Police Memorial Wall in Washington DC. The National Memorial Committee lists Officers’ names that will be engraved into the wall. We will be riding for:

This is a charity ride that raises money and awareness for the Illinois Chapter of Concerns Of Police Survivors, which includes the surviving family members, loved ones and co-workers of fallen officers. This ride has become an annual journey for all our riders, especially our survivors. During our ride, we will be in the presence of families, homes and departments of fallen police officers. We will respect the privacy and confidentiality of our survivors. We hope you will contribute to this worthy cause.
